Mile Marker Zero Biography

Mile Marker Zero was formed in 2005 when brothers, vocalist Dave Alley and drummer Doug Alley, alongside childhood friend keyboardist Mark Focarile, met guitarist John Tuohy and original bassist Tim Rykoski at Western Connecticut State University. They released their debut EP, The Haunted, in 2006, and began to captivate audiences as they were seen performing alongside the likes of Porcupine Tree, Underoath, Spock’s Beard, and Devil Wears Prada.

Having created a buzz on the Northeastern prog circuit, the band returned to the studio to record their debut full-length effort in 2009, and were the first-ever unsigned artist to be featured in the popular Harmonix/MTV Games videogame series, RockBand.
MMZ continued to make several live appearances, including gigs with Periphery, Scale the Summit, Nothing More, Adrenaline Mob, Fair to Midland, and more. In 2014, the band released their most acclaimed effort to date, the electrifying Young Rust EP, which was lauded as “a must-listen for fans of commercial progressive music” (Metal Insider) and saw the band receive the award for “Best Band (Connecticut)” at the New England Music Awards.
As to the overall scope of the new album, vocalist Dave Alley observes, “The Fifth Row is a reference to the legend of ‘rice and the chessboard,’ and is frequently used by futurists as a way to show exponential growth in technology. As a society, humanity is currently in the ‘fifth row’ of the chessboard, a time which changes in technology happen so fast that they are almost impossible to accurately forecast or predict. The role of artificial intelligence and technology in our lives is a pretty hot topic right now. When we decided that we were going to do a concept album, it just seemed like the perfect topic to dive into, given how we grew up and how technology influenced our lives.”

MMZ are supporting the Fifth Row with live shows including RosFest in Sarasota, FL alongside Martin Barre of of Jethro Tull and Riverside.
